Grounds for election

Martin Allfrey has worked as a head curator for English Heritage for many years on a wide range of projects including the conservation of Brodsworth Hall, Yorkshire, after it came into state care. He is currently responsible for English Heritage collections and historic interiors in the west of England, covering properties from Cheshire to Cornwall. He has recently worked with the Centre for the Study of Japanese Arts and Cultures on the temporary exhibition ‘Circles of Stone: Stonehenge & Jomon Japan’ at Stonehenge. He is also working with Bournemouth University on a research project called ‘Scaling Up Human Henge’ exploring the power of ancient places to contribute to people’s mental health and well-being.
